A section of Ilepo Market at Oke Odo, Lagos State, has been set on fire as hoodlums clashed with traders in the market over bet money.
Some witnesses revealed that the crisis started on Wednesday evening and escalated Thursday. The police are on the ground trying to restore normalcy.
“One of the traders in the market played lotto (bet Naija) and won N13,000 but was given N11,000 and because of the N2,000 balance which was not given to him started the fighting .
“The hoodlums from the nearby market used the opportunity to start looting and burning property in the market. They looted a lot of shops, carted away food items and valuables.
“As I am speaking to you, we cannot enter the market, but police are currently there trying to calm the situation, I can hear sounds of tear gas. We have lost millions of naira in the market,” a trader, Aminu Muhammad Sa’id, told the Newsmen.
